Energy pooling in Na 3pNa 3p collisions

Abstract

The formation of Na (nl) and Na2+ in sodium vapor (∼1013 cm3) irradiated by a single-frequency (20-MHz bandwidth) cw dye laser tuned to one of the D lines has been studied. The dependence of product signal on laser power density suggests that Na 3p-Na 3p energy pooling collisions are responsible for these species. Rate constants for specific reaction channels and temperature dependences of rate constants are also reported.
